Converting 132 lbs to kg: The Calculation
The conversion factor between pounds and kilograms is approximately 2.Now, 20462 lbs per kg. That said, this means that one kilogram is equal to 2. 20462 pounds.
132 lbs / 2.20462 lbs/kg ≈ 59.87 kg
That's why, 132 pounds is approximately equal to 59.87 kilograms. you'll want to note that this is an approximation, as the conversion factor is not a whole number. For most practical purposes, rounding to one or two decimal places is sufficient.
Understanding the Imperial and Metric Systems
To fully grasp the conversion, let's briefly examine the two systems involved:
-
Imperial System: This system, primarily used in the United States and a few other countries, is based on historical units like pounds, feet, and inches. The pound (lb) is a unit of mass, often used interchangeably with weight in everyday life. The imperial system lacks a consistent base unit, leading to complexities in conversions.
-
Metric System (SI): The International System of Units (SI), or metric system, is a decimal system based on the meter, kilogram, and second. The kilogram (kg) is the base unit of mass in the SI system. The metric system's decimal nature makes conversions within the system straightforward, involving only powers of 10.

Other Relevant Weight Conversions
While we’ve focused on converting 132 lbs to kg, understanding related conversions can be beneficial:
-
Converting Kilograms to Pounds: To convert kilograms to pounds, simply multiply the weight in kilograms by 2.20462.
-
Converting Ounces to Grams: Another common conversion is from ounces (oz) to grams (g). There are approximately 28.35 grams in one ounce.
-
Converting Stones to Kilograms: The stone (st), a unit of weight mainly used in the UK, is equal to 14 pounds. Which means, to convert stones to kilograms, first convert to pounds, and then to kilograms using the conversion factor mentioned earlier.
